一种网络切换方法、装置、存储介质及终端制造方法及图纸

技术编号:22726507 阅读:39 留言:0更新日期:2019-12-04 07:23
本申请实施例公开了一种网络切换方法、装置、存储介质及终端,其中,所述方法包括:获取当前驻留的第一网络的数据传输参数;当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;当所述第二网络的信号强度大于或者等于第一网络接入门限值时,从所述第一网络切换至所述第二网络并进行驻留;其中,所述第一网络的优先级高于所述第二网络的优先级。在热点地区采用本申请实施例,既能保证用户的上网体验,又能充分利用第二网络的闲置资源。

A network switching method, device, storage medium and terminal

The embodiment of the application discloses a network switching method, device, storage medium and terminal, wherein the method comprises: acquiring data transmission parameters of the first network currently residing; acquiring signal strength of the second network when the data transmission parameters meet the network reselection conditions; acquiring signal strength of the second network when the signal strength of the second network is greater than or equal to the access threshold of the first network When switching from the first network to the second network and resident, the priority of the first network is higher than that of the second network. The embodiment of the application can not only ensure the user's online experience, but also make full use of the idle resources of the second network.

【技术实现步骤摘要】
一种网络切换方法、装置、存储介质及终端
本申请涉及计算机
,尤其涉及一种网络切换方法、装置、存储介质及终端。
技术介绍
随着电子信息科技的迅猛发展,人们对于移动互联网的需求不断增长,随之而来的,是对移动终端通信质量提出了更高的要求。在诸如商场、地铁、体育馆等人员密集的热点地区,网络覆盖虽然能涉及到每一片区域,网络信号也有保证,但由于人数众多,网络承载能力有限,分配给一些用户的资源可能会很少,在使用移动终端的过程中,就会出现刷不出网页、消息发送失败等上网失败的情况,从而导致数据业务体验差。
技术实现思路
本申请实施例提供了一种网络切换方法、装置、存储介质及终端,可以解决在数据业务差时,不能将当前驻留的网络切换至满足条件的其他网络的问题。所述技术方案如下:第一方面,本申请实施例提供了一种网络切换方法,所述方法包括:获取当前驻留的第一网络的数据传输参数;当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;当所述第二网络的信号强度大于或者等于网络接入第一门限值时,从所述第一网络切换至所述第二网络并进行驻留;其中,所述第一网络的优先级高于所述第二网络的优先级。第二方面,本申请实施例提供了一种网络切换装置,所述装置包括:数据传输参数获取模块,用于获取当前驻留的第一网络的数据传输参数;信号强度获取模块,用于当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;网络切换模块,用于当所述第二网络的信号强度大于或者等于网络接入第一门限值时,从所述第一网络切换至所述第二网络并进行驻留;其中,所述第一网络的优先级高于所述第二网络的优先级。第三方面,本申请实施例提供了一种计算机可读存储介质,其上存储有计算机程序,该程序被处理器执行时实现上述任一项方法的步骤。第四方面,本申请实施例提供了一种终端,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述程序时实现上述任一项方法的步骤。本申请一些实施例提供的技术方案带来的有益效果至少包括:在本申请中的一个或多个实施例中,终端在获取到当前驻留的第一网络的数据传输参数后,先对所述数据传输参数进行条件判断,当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;基于获取到的所述第二网络的信号强度大于或者等于网络接入第一门限值,从所述第一网络切换至所述第二网络并进行驻留;其中,所述第一网络的优先级高于所述第二网络的优先级。在热点地区,当优先级较高的第一网络分配给部分用户的资源较少而导致数据业务差时,运用本申请实施例,能够将当前驻留的第一网络切换至优先级相对较低、且有闲置资源供用户正常获取业务数据的第二网络,既保证了用户上网体验,又充分利用了第二网络的闲置资源。附图说明为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。图1是本申请实施例提供的一种网络切换方法的流程示意图;图2是本申请实施例提供的一种网络切换方法的流程示意图;图3是本申请实施例提供的一种网络切换方法的流程示意图;图4是本申请实施例提供的一种网络切换装置的结构示意图;图5是本申请实施例提供的一种终端结构框图。具体实施方式为使本申请的目的、技术方案和优点更加清楚,下面将结合附图对本申请实施例方式作进一步地详细描述。下面的描述涉及附图时,除非另有表示,不同附图中的相同数字表示相同或相似的要素。以下示例性实施例中所描述的实施方式并不代表与本申请相一致的所有实施方式。相反,它们仅是如所附权利要求书中所详述的、本申请的一些方面相一致的装置和方法的例子。在本申请的描述中,需要理解的是,术语“第一”、“第二”等仅用于描述目的,而不能理解为指示或暗示相对重要性。对于本领域的普通技术人员而言,可以具体情况理解上述术语在本申请中的具体含义。此外,在本申请的描述中,除非另有说明,“多个”是指两个或两个以上。“和/或”,描述关联对象的关联关系,表示可以存在三种关系,例如,A和/或B,可以表示:单独存在A,同时存在A和B,单独存在B这三种情况。字符“/”一般表示前后关联对象是一种“或”的关系。下面将结合附图1-附图3,对本申请实施例提供的网络切换方法进行详细介绍。请参见图1,为本申请实施例提供的一种网络切换方法的流程示意图。如图1所示,本申请实施例的所述方法可以包括以下步骤:S101,获取当前驻留的第一网络的数据传输参数;驻留即停留;将终端当前连接并驻留的网络定义为第一网络,为知晓所述第一网络的网络状况,需获取数据传输参数,凡是能够表明网络状况的参数均可作为数据传输参数。具体地,将所述数据传输参数与相对应的、用来划分网络状况好与坏的临界值进行比较,当比较结果表明当前驻留的第一网络的网络状况良好时,说明用户能够及时获取到相应的业务数据,如获取到新闻资讯、及时接收/发送社交网站上的聊天信息等,此时终端可继续驻留在所述第一网络;当比较结果表明当前驻留的第一网络的网络状况差时,说明用户不能及时获取到相应的业务数据,相应的表现为,当前所处的应用程序界面上会出现连接超时、服务器无响应等提示。S102,当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;当所述数据传输参数与相对应的、用来划分网络状况好与坏的临界值的比较结果表明网络状况差时,即满足网络重选条件。网络重选是终端在非Cell-DCH状态下完成的网络再选择。具体而言,当终端驻留在第一网络时,随着终端的移动,当前驻留的网络其网络状况和附近其他网络的网络状况都在不断变化。若所驻留的网络其网络状况越来越差,当表征网络状况的参数跨过一个门限值时,终端便开始测量其他网络的网络状况,选择一个更合适的网络进行驻留。当其他网络的网络状况好于当前所驻留网络的网络状况时,终端就进行网络的重新选择。将被测量的网络称为第二网络,对于该网络,终端需要获取其信号强度以确定该网络的网络状况是否良好。本实施例中,被测量的网络可以是一个网络,也可以是多个网络。当被测量的网络为多个网络时,可以定义优先级最高的网络为第二网络,也可以定义信号最强的网络为第二网络。S103,当所述第二网络的信号强度大于或者等于网络接入第一门限值时,从所述第一网络切换至所述第二网络并进行驻留;其中,所述第一网络的优先级高于所述第二网络的优先级。本实施例在所述数据传输参数满足网络重选条件时,还需要判断第二网络的信号强度是否满足网络切换条件,在所述第二网络的信号强度满足网络切换条件时方可实施切换。网络切换条件是指第二网络的信号强度不能低于该网络的信号强度阈值。具体地,将获取到的第二网络的信号强度与网络接入第一门限值进本文档来自技高网...

【技术保护点】
1.一种网络切换方法,其特征在于,所述方法包括:/n获取当前驻留的第一网络的数据传输参数;/n当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;/n当所述第二网络的信号强度大于或者等于网络接入第一门限值时,从所述第一网络切换至所述第二网络并进行驻留;/n其中,所述第一网络的优先级高于所述第二网络的优先级。/n

【技术特征摘要】
1.一种网络切换方法,其特征在于,所述方法包括:
获取当前驻留的第一网络的数据传输参数;
当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度;
当所述第二网络的信号强度大于或者等于网络接入第一门限值时,从所述第一网络切换至所述第二网络并进行驻留;
其中,所述第一网络的优先级高于所述第二网络的优先级。


2.根据权利要求1所述的方法,其特征在于,所述获取当前驻留的第一网络的数据传输参数,包括:
获取当前驻留的第一网络的数据响应时长;
所述当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度,包括:
当所述数据响应时长大于设定的第一时长时,获取第二网络的信号强度。


3.根据权利要求1所述的方法,其特征在于,所述获取当前驻留的第一网络的数据传输参数,包括:
获取当前驻留的第一网络在设定的第二时长内的平均数据传输速率;
所述当所述数据传输参数满足网络重选条件时,获取第二网络的信号强度,包括:
当所述平均数据传输速率小于数据传输速率阈值时,获取第二网络的信号强度。


4.根据权利要求3所述的方法,其特征在于,所述当所述平均数据传输速率小于数据传输速率阈值时,获取第二网络的信号强度,包括:
当所述平均数据传输速率小于数据传输速率阈值时,启动第一定时器并获取第二网络的信号强度;
所述当所述第二网络的信号强度大于或者等于网络接入第一门限值时,从所述第一网络切换至所述第二网络并进行驻留,包括:
当所述第二网络的信号强度大于或者等于网络接入第一门限值,且所述第一定时器超时时,从所述第一网络切换至所述第二网络并进行驻留。


5.根据权利要求4所述的方法,其特征在于,所述当所述第二网络的信号强度大于或者等于网络...

【专利技术属性】
技术研发人员:刘建峰
申请(专利权)人:宇龙计算机通信科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1